  6. Hi, great question. I blog to share any information about classroom to all my students and world as well. As lecturer, it is important to guide regarding the new material about urban planning (for example) that we never teach in the classroom. For instance there is something new on a data science discipline that is very important in the smart city discussion. We, as urban planner, never learn and discuss data science but we always talk about smart city.

    This new insight is something important to share with each other on blog, and I do that. Not only for smart city but also the usage of technology on research. We have to upgrade our skill on research with mastering some software. In this part, we need to share the experience of using software on blog.

    That’s why blogging is ‘a the best way’ to share.
